We use RAl colours a lot in the furniture industry to ensure matches of finish between manufacturers, had a look at the RAL charts and there are a handful of whites to choose from, however as Fuji white is mixed to Land Rover's specification rather than to a RAL standard it will be almost impossible to find an exact match, as K9F says the best thing is to have paint mixed to match the code on the vin plate 👍👍

RAL is a colour matching system used in Europe. In colloquial speech RAL refers to the RAL Classic system, mainly used for varnish and powder coating but nowadays there are reference panels for plastics as well. Vehicle manufactures very rarely use RAL colours and usually creat their own which are given a unique reference.

See https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/RAL_colour_standard for further info on the RAL colour standard. T

he UK has a seperate standard BS 381C, BS4800 and BS5252 - see http://www.e-paint.co.uk/BS381%20Colourchart.asp

Then there is the NCS system ...... (Dulux mixed paint is based on this)

This site - http://coachpainting.info/index.html - is great as it gives most Land Rover used the first column being the paint ref - body shops work to this or the last column is the LR code (used when ordering a touch up kit fro a dealer etc)
